SQLite查询要加入一定范围的日期?

SQLite查询要加入一定范围的日期?,第1张

SQLite查询要加入一定范围的日期?

创建一个日历表并加入该表:

这样的事情会做:

create table dates (id integer primary key);insert into dates default values;insert into dates default values;insert into dates select null from dates d1, dates d2, dates d3 , dates d4;insert into dates select null from dates d1, dates d2, dates d3 , dates d4;alter table dates add date datetime;update dates set date=date('2000-01-01',(-1+id)||' day');

直到2287-05-20为止,您都可以使用。在dates表的date列中添加索引不会有任何问题。我的sqlite有点生锈,因此建议您参考该手册。

编辑: 索引代码:

create unique index ux_dates_date on dates (date);


欢迎分享,转载请注明来源:内存溢出

原文地址: https://www.outofmemory.cn/zaji/5144449.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2022-11-18
下一篇 2022-11-18

发表评论

登录后才能评论

评论列表(0条)

保存